帕金森病伴抑郁患者静息态下脑活动的局部一致性改变
Alterations in regional homogeneity of resting state brain activity in Parkinson's disease patients with depression

摘要
目的 运用静息态功能磁共振探讨帕金森病伴抑郁患者脑局部一致性(ReHo)的变化及其与抑郁之间的关系.方法 收集2017年6月至10月于南京医科大学附属脑科医院门诊就诊的62例帕金森病患者(不伴抑郁组42例、伴抑郁组20例)、20例抑郁症患者及47名健康对照的静息态功能磁共振成像数据,进行2×2的协方差分析,比较4组间的ReHo差异,并将存在组间差异的脑区的ReHo值与汉密尔顿抑郁量表( HAMD)、统一帕金森病评定量表第三部分( UPDRS-Ⅲ)评分以及Hoehn-Yahr分期进行相关分析.结果 帕金森病主效应作用下,帕金森病组ReHo增高的脑区主要位于左侧腹外侧前额叶和右侧楔前叶,降低的脑区主要位于两侧辅助运动区、左侧角回.抑郁主效应作用下,抑郁组ReHo在两侧小脑增高,而在两侧中央前回、中央后回、左侧额下回、左侧后扣带回、左侧辅助运动区、右侧背外侧前额叶、右侧顶下叶、右侧距状裂降低.帕金森病与抑郁交互作用的脑区包括双侧额中回、左侧额下回及右侧缘上回.抑郁主效应下差异脑区右侧背外侧前额叶(r=-0.526,P<0.01)、顶下叶(r=-0.456,P<0.01) ReHo值与HAMD评分均存在明显的负相关.结论 伴抑郁的帕金森病患者静息状态下存在脑功能异常,且帕金森病患者出现抑郁并不是帕金森病及抑郁症两者的叠加.
Abstract
Objective To investigate the changes of regional homogeneity ( ReHo) in Parkinson's disease (PD) patients with depression and their relationship with major depressive disorder.Methods A total of 42 PD patients without depression , 20 PD patients with depression, 20 major depressive disorder patients and 47 well-matched healthy controls were scanned with resting-state functional magnetic resonance imaging for ReHo analysis.The Hamilton Depression Scale (HAMD), Unified Parkinson's Disease Rating Scale (UPDRS-Ⅲ) and Hoehn-Yahr stage were used to assess the clinical symptoms , then the correlations between abnormal brain regions and clinical data were explored.Results ( 1 ) The main effect of Parkinson's disease: PD group showed higher ReHo in left ventrolateral prefrontal cortex and right precuneus, but lower ReHo in bilateral supplementary motor area and left angular gyrus.(2) The main effect of depression: The depression group had increased ReHo in bilateral cerebellum , and decreased ReHo in bilateral precentral gyrus , postcentral gyrus , left inferior frontal gyrus, left posterior cingulate gyrus , left supplementary motor area , right dorsolateral prefrontal cortex , right inferior parietal gyrus and right calcarine.(3) Interactive effect of PD and depression : Interactive brain areas included bilateral middle frontal gyrus, left inferior frontal cortex and supramarginal gyrus.(4) The ReHo of the brain regions under main effect of depression including right dorsolateral prefrontal cortex (r=-0.526, P<0.01) and right inferior parietal gyrus ( r=-0.456, P<0.01) had significant negative correlation with HAMD scores. Conclusion PD patients with depression have abnormal brain function , and PD with depression is not simply an overlay of PD and major depressive disorder.
